DENVER (AP) - Hoping to see Missy Franklin swim at her final high school state meet?

Sorry, it's a sold-out show.

Franklin, a four-time Olympic gold medalist, will compete for Regis Jesuit High School in the 200-yard individual medley and 500 free - along with two more relay events - at the Class 5A state championships this weekend in Fort Collins, Colo.

There really weren't that many tickets available for purchase.

The Colorado High School Activities Association allocated 922 of the roughly 990 tickets to schools so that all parents of qualified swimmers had a chance to see their kids swim. The few remaining tickets went fast, especially with fans of Franklin hoping to see the 17-year-old compete one final time in her prep career before heading off to the University of California, Berkeley.
